Role Description As an Analog Design Engineer at Tylsemi, you will design and deliver high-performance analog and mixed-signal circuits that enable robust, manufacturable silicon. This role spans a wide experience range (5–30 years) and is ideal for engineers who combine strong fundamentals with practical execution—translating system requirements into silicon-ready designs, validating performance across corners, and partnering closely with layout, verification, test, and product teams to drive first-time-right outcomes. - Own end-to-end analog block development: requirements definition, architecture, transistor-level design, simulation, and signoff - Design and optimize analog/mixed-signal circuits such as amplifiers, references, biasing, regulators (LDO/DC-DC support), comparators, oscillators/clocking, data converters (as applicable), and sensor/AFE front ends - Drive performance across PVT corners, mismatch/Monte Carlo, aging/reliability considerations, and realistic loading/interaction with surrounding blocks - Partner with layout to guide floorplanning, matching/guarding strategies, parasitic-aware design, and post-layout closure (PEX) - Develop and maintain testbenches, modeling collateral, and documentation to enable efficient verification and integration - Support silicon bring-up and debug: correlate lab data to simulations, root-cause issues, and implement design fixes or ECOs - Collaborate cross-functionally with digital, firmware, DFT, validation, and product engineering to ensure system-level success - Contribute to design methodology improvements: reusable circuits, checklists, signoff flows, and best practices that scale across programs Qualifications - 5+ years of experience in analog or mixed-signal IC design (scope and ownership aligned to experience level) - Strong fundamentals in analog circuit design, device physics, noise, stability/compensation, and feedback systems - Proficiency with industry-standard EDA tools and simulation flows (e.g., Spectre/HSPICE, ADE, waveform/debug tooling) - Experience closing designs through post-layout parasitics and across process/voltage/temperature corners - Ability to translate ambiguous system needs into clear block requirements and executable design plans - Strong debugging skills and comfort working with lab/validation teams to correlate silicon to simulation - Clear communication and high ownership in cross-site, cross-functional environments Requirements - Experience with high-speed or precision analog (low-noise, low-offset, high-linearity) depending on product needs - Background in power management (LDOs, bandgaps, references, protection, start-up, transient response) - ADC/DAC, PLL/clocking, or SERDES-adjacent analog experience - Familiarity with reliability/ESD considerations and design-for-manufacturability practices - Experience supporting production ramp: yield learning, characterization, and test correlation Success in This Role Looks Like - Analog blocks meet spec with margin across PVT, mismatch, and post-layout effects - Design reviews are crisp: requirements, tradeoffs, and risks are clearly articulated and managed - Silicon bring-up converges quickly through strong correlation, structured debug, and decisive fixes - Cross-functional partners (layout, verification, test, validation) can execute efficiently with clear interfaces and documentation - Reusable design collateral and improved methodology reduce cycle time and increase first-pass success
